Description

The Lily Angled Front Pocket Crossbody Purse features one zipper front pocket and two slip back pockets. It has a secure zipper closure and three 4″ inside slip pockets.

This beginner-friendly pattern is created for vinyl or cork as an accent fabric but contains alternative instruction if you are using regular fabric and can’t have exposed edges.

A bonus pattern and instruction for the tassel are also included.

Finished size:
10” wide by 8.5” tall by 3” deep.

Skill level:
Beginner-friendly

Supplies needed:
• Vinyl (or cork fabric) – 12” x 9” (plus optional – accent on strap 54”x 0.5” & tassel 4.5” x 5.5”)
• Waterproof Canvas – 14”x 30”
• Lining – ½ yard (I’m using cotton)
• Zipper – 1.25” zipper tape one 9” (for pocket) + 13” (top of purse) & 2 zipper pulls
• Back pocket closure – 2 sets of magnetic snaps (you can use regular snaps or leave them without any close as slip pockets)
• Thread – polyester thread
• Purse strap – (2) 0.75-inch key fob hardware in place of D-rings | (2) 1” swivel clasps |54” of polyester webbing | 1” strap adjuster
